Elise Finch Remembered: A Legacy of Love and Service
The CBS News New York family is reflecting on the life and contributions of meteorologist Elise Finch, marking two years since her untimely passing. Finch, who was a cherished member of the team since 2007, was remembered not just for her weather forecasts, but for her vibrant spirit and dedication to her community.
A Fond Farewell
Elise’s sudden departure in 2023 at the age of 51 left a void in the hearts of many. Her colleagues, friends, and family gathered to pay tribute on July 16, a day marked with sadness yet filled with stories of her kindness and passion for journalism.
A Hall of Fame Honor
In a posthumous recognition of her impact, Finch was recently inducted into the Mount Vernon High School Hall of Fame. This honor reflects her journey from a young girl in Mount Vernon to a respected meteorologist, showcasing her dedication to excellence.
Tributes Pour In
Local organizations and individuals have shared their affection and respect for Finch through moving tributes. Among them, the Boys and Girls Club of Mount Vernon honored her contributions to the community during a special event aimed at empowering youth.
Community Initiatives in Her Name
The nonprofit G.O.O.D. for Girls, Inc. has introduced an educational scholarship in Finch’s memory, designed to mentor young girls and inspire future leaders. This initiative is a testament to her lasting legacy and commitment to improving the lives of others.
